>> >> >I have one table which name is medicalhistory which structure is as
>> >> >follows.
>> >> >
>> >> > ID int
>> >> > TId int
>> >> > TableName nvarchar(100)
>> >> > FieldName nvarchar(100)
>> >> > Comm1 nvarchar(4000)
>> >> > Comm2 nvarchar(4000)
>> >> > CDate datetime
>> >> > SCDate datetime
>> >> >
>> >> > The problem is that when I use the following query like.
>> >> >
>> >> > select count(*) from medicalhistory
>> >> >
>> >> > It is continously running and doesn't give me any result, so I get
> the
>> >> > count
>> >> > from the following query
>> >> >
>> >> > select rowcnt from sysindexes where id = object_id('medicalhistory')
>> >> >
>> >> > 12819530
>> >> >
>> >> > There is no index in the above table and I also use the following
>> > command
>> >> > for consistency error.
>> >> >
>> >> > DBCC Checktable ('medicalhistory')
>> >> >
>> >> > Result:-
>> >> > DBCC results for 'medicalhistory'.
>> >> > There are 12819530 rows in 218027 pages for object 'medicalhistory'.
>> >> > DBCC execution completed. If DBCC printed error messages, contact
> your
>> >> > system administrator.
>> >> >
>> >> > Even when I use this command like
>> >> >
>> >> > select * from medicalhistory where ID = 523662
>> >> >
>> >> > It is continously running and doesn't give me any result
>> >> >
>> >> > Can any one give me his or her expert idea like this is the table
>> >> > corruption
>> >> > or what the problem is ?
>> >> >
>> >> > What I have to do now?
>> >> >
>> >> > Thanks in advance.
